Saturday, May 4, 2019

KUTX’s Sunday Morning Jazz Presents Chick Corea & Béla Fleck Duet

Chick Corea & Béla Fleck, two master songwriters, musicians, and band leaders meet in a historic duet of piano and banjo. The Grammy Award-winning duet will combine Corea and Fleck’s most recognizable tunes with music from their Latin Grammy-winning album, The Enchantment, and their extraordinary live set Two (originally released in 2015 and now available on vinyl as well). With a mix of jazz and pop standards crossing a myriad of genres, from jazz, bluegrass, rock, flamenco and gospel, this will be a casual, intimate evening with two legends from different musical worlds.
